Given Input numbers are 522, 478, 860, 350
In the factoring method, we have to find the divisors of all numbers
Divisors of 522 :
The positive integer divisors of 522 that completely divides 522 are.
1, 2, 3, 6, 9, 18, 29, 58, 87, 174, 261, 522
Divisors of 478 :
The positive integer divisors of 478 that completely divides 478 are.
1, 2, 239, 478
Divisors of 860 :
The positive integer divisors of 860 that completely divides 860 are.
1, 2, 4, 5, 10, 20, 43, 86, 172, 215, 430, 860
Divisors of 350 :
The positive integer divisors of 350 that completely divides 350 are.
1, 2, 5, 7, 10, 14, 25, 35, 50, 70, 175, 350
GCD of numbers is the greatest common divisor
So, the GCD (522, 478, 860, 350) = 2.
